A unique photograph of the composer Stefan Wolpe (b.1902, Berlin; d.1992, New York City), the print made by its photographer, Robert Kostka (1928-2005), who was also a distinguished American painter and ceramicist. Photo is not signed, but I can attest to its authenticity because Robert Kostka was my mentor and the photo and accompanying article were mailed to me many years ago by him. The article, from the Chicago Reader, announces a "Chicago Stefan Wolfe Festival" (publication date given in Kostka's hand incorrectly, however). CONDITION: The photo is clear, uncreased, and unscratched, with minimal edge-wear - though there is a tiny chip in the upper-left corner (not intruding into the image frame). The newspaper article has only a hint of age-tanning. These rare items are now in a clear, protective polypropylene bag with archival backing board.
